> +static int upload_func(int argc, char *argv[])
> +{
> + char *filename;
> + char id[XEN_XSPLICE_NAME_SIZE];
> + int fd = 0, rc;
> + struct stat buf;
> + unsigned char *fbuf;
> + ssize_t len;
> + DECLARE_HYPERCALL_BUFFER(char, payload);
> +
I don't think you need to declare hypercall buffer here in the utility.
It should be libxc's responsibility to bounce the buffer accordingly.
